首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

根据当日日期选择用户的MySql查询

根据当日日期选择用户的MySQL查询是一种根据当前日期来筛选和查询MySQL数据库中的数据的操作。以下是完善且全面的答案:

概念: 根据当日日期选择用户的MySQL查询是指根据当前日期来过滤和检索MySQL数据库中的数据。通过使用特定的日期函数和语句,可以根据日期条件来选择特定日期范围内的数据。

分类: 这种查询可以根据不同的需求进行分类,例如按年份、月份、日期、星期等进行查询。

优势:

  • 精确性:根据当日日期选择用户的MySQL查询可以确保只选择符合特定日期条件的数据,提供了更准确的结果。
  • 自动化:通过使用日期函数和语句,可以实现自动化的查询,无需手动输入日期条件。
  • 灵活性:可以根据不同的需求进行灵活的日期筛选,满足不同场景下的查询要求。

应用场景:

  • 订单管理系统:根据当日日期选择用户的MySQL查询可以用于筛选当天的订单数据,以便进行日常订单管理和统计。
  • 日志分析系统:可以使用这种查询来选择特定日期范围内的日志数据,以便进行日志分析和故障排查。
  • 数据报表系统:根据当日日期选择用户的MySQL查询可以用于生成每日、每周或每月的数据报表,以便进行业务分析和决策。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 云数据库 MySQL:腾讯云提供的稳定可靠的云数据库服务,支持高可用、弹性扩展和自动备份等功能。了解更多:https://cloud.tencent.com/product/cdb

示例代码: 以下是一个示例的MySQL查询语句,用于根据当日日期选择用户的数据:

代码语言:txt
复制
SELECT * FROM users WHERE DATE(created_at) = CURDATE();

上述查询语句将选择在当前日期创建的用户数据。可以根据具体需求修改日期条件和表名。

请注意,以上答案仅供参考,具体的实现方式和产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MySQL根据输入查询条件排序

问题      现在一个需求是查询某一列,用逗号分开,返回结果要根据输入顺序返回结果      比如:姓名输入框输入是(zhangsan,lisi),那么返回结果也要是按照(zhangsan,...lisi)这样顺序展示 测试 有如下表classroom,内容如下 如果根据字段名称去查,那么它会根据字典顺序排序,如下所示 select * from classroom where classname...in ("class2","class3") order by classname 如果想根据我in里面的顺序去排序,那么只能是如下所示 select * from classroom where classname...in ("class2","class3") order by field(classname,"class3","class2") 如果我想在原来基础上,在根据时间排序 select * from...条件必须比 in 里面的查询条件多,如果少一个,那么这个排序就不会成功 //成功 select * from classroom where classname in ("class2","class3

19110
  • vue+element踩坑记-根据用户选择日期重置当前表头第一位

    需求分析 我记得之前我是写过一篇文章,写是怎么根据用户选择天数来重置当前表头数量,那么当时我写是将天数改变,但是一直没有改变是开始日期,我当时写是没有处理好第一天日期,所以一直没有更新,...那么其实我们既然是需要定制自己表头的话,开始日期一般是不会固定,所以我们今天就简单写一下怎么根据用户输入日期来改变表头第一天日期。...100%;"> <el-table-column prop="room_type" label="可预定数/<em>当日</em>价... /** * @set_time 重置<em>用户</em><em>选择</em><em>的</em>时间...,有的人会直接重置当前<em>用户</em><em>选择</em><em>的</em><em>日期</em>,而不是最终赋值<em>的</em>那个数据,那么其实是不对<em>的</em>,如果不是最终绑定<em>的</em>数据的话,会导致<em>的</em>一个问题是我们<em>的</em>数据会被不停<em>的</em>重置,而不是我们需要<em>的</em>数据,自己<em>的</em>写<em>的</em>时候就会明白了。

    73410

    Django框架开发015期 数据查询根据搜索条件查询用户

    开发用户查询页面,我们从实际用户查询行为角度出发,我们需要做如下开发: 1)修改用户列表页面,增加一个查询功能; 2)增加一个搜索页面,显示搜索得到结果; 3)开发路由,用于显示搜索信息结果页;...4)开发一个视图函数,用于接收用户查询信息并返回查询结果。...由于这里我们是做查询信息,所以我们重新开发一个新视图函数专门用于显示查询结果,这样表述比较清晰。当然,有的读者可能会问:“我能不能把这个功能开发在用户列表显示视图函数中?”...第4步:开发视图函数 #根据用户姓名查询获取数据结果 def getLjyUserByName(request): mykey=request.GET['mykey'] #接收form表单中提交关键词.../ljySearch.html',{'userlist':users})#将查询结果传递给查询结果页面,类似之前用户信息列表 我们在代码中已经对查询整个过程语句已经做了详细解释。

    31420

    MySQL Hints:控制查询优化器选择

    这些Hints通常被用于解决性能问题,或者当开发者比优化器更了解数据分布和查询特性时,来指导优化器选择更好查询计划。...二、为什么需要使用Hints 性能调优:在某些复杂查询场景下,优化器可能无法自动选择最优执行计划。通过Hints,我们可以手动指定一些执行策略,从而提升查询性能。...这通常基于你对查询性能分析和对MySQL优化器行为理解。例如,如果你发现优化器没有选择你认为最优索引,你可能会想要使用FORCE INDEX或IGNORE INDEX等Hints。 2....STRAIGHT_JOIN STRAIGHT_JOIN用于强制MySQL按照指定表顺序进行JOIN操作,而不是由优化器自动选择。...监控和调优:即使使用了Hints,也应该定期监控查询性能,并根据需要进行调整。 七、结语 MySQL Hints是一种强大工具,可以帮助我们解决复杂查询性能问题。

    27310

    配置mysql用户权限并查询数据

    MySQL安装后,需要允许外部IP访问数据库。修改加密配置与增加新用户,配置用户权限 修改配置文件,增加默认加密方式配置项。...当连接数据库时候会报验证方法不存在错误,这是因为新版本mysql加密规则有变化,所以连不上数据库,具体可以看官网文档。...可以修改mysql配置文件,修改加密规则为原来那种,然后重新加密下所使用用户密码。...官网文档地址:https://dev.mysql.com/doc/refman/8.0/en/caching-sha2-pluggable-authentication.html 修改MySQL用户加密方式...允许外部IP访问,当使用root用户时候,直接修改root用户Host字段 update user set host = '%' where user = 'root'; 创建一个用户并且赋予权限

    1.8K20

    mysql查询每个用户第一条记录_mysql怎么创建用户

    数据库记录: MYSQL查询不同用户 最新一条记录 方法1:查询出结果后将时间排序后取第一条(只能取到一条,并且不能查询不同客户记录) SELECT CUSTOMER_ID,CONTENT,MODIFY_TIME...,排列好值作为子查询a,然后再根据查询a按照CUSTOMER_ID分组) SELECT CUSTOMER_ID,CONTENT,MODIFY_TIME FROM (SELECT CUSTOMER_ID...: group by 可以根据group by 参数列分组,但返回结果只有一条,仔细观察发现group by是将分组后第一条记录返回。...时间在查询后默认是顺序排列,因此需要先将时间倒序排列,方可取出距离当前最近一条。这样查询实际上还是进行了两次查询。...所以正确写法是第二种,先正确排好序,然后再利用group by 分组 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。

    6.8K10

    MySql根据当前页pageNo、显示条数pageSize,实现分页查询SQL

    )两个参数去分页查询数据库表中数据,那我们知道MySql数据库提供了分页函数limit m,n,但是该函数用法和我们需求不一样,所以就需要我们根据实际情况去改写适合我们自己分页语句,具体分析如下...: 比如: 查询第1条到第10条数据sql是:select * from table limit 0,10; ->对应我们需求就是查询第一页数据:select * from table limit...(1-1)*10,10; 查询第10条到第20条数据sql是:select * from table limit 10,20; ->对应我们需求就是查询第二页数据:select * from...table limit (2-1)*10,10; 查询第20条到第30条数据sql是:select * from table limit 20,30; ->对应我们需求就是查询第三页数据:select...* from table limit (3-1)*10,10; 二:通过上面的分析,可以得出符合我们自己需求分页sql格式 mysql分页:select * from 表 limit (pageNo

    3.9K20

    一条命令查询所有mysql用户授权信息

    需求除了导数据外, 有时候还要导出用户授权信息.而官方show grants 命令一次只能查询一个用户SHOW GRANTS [FOR user]常用做法就是写脚本, 但这么个小事情还专门写脚本就太麻烦了...实现我们可以通过如下SQL得到查询所有用户授权信息SQLselect concat('show grants for "',user,'"@"',host,'";') from mysql.user;...;""" | mysql -h127.0.0.1 -P3308 -p123456 -NB | mysql -h127.0.0.1 -P3308 -p123456 -NB图片这样便得到了所有用户授权信息...user,'\"@\"',host,'\";') from mysql.user;""" | $MYSQL_CONN|$MYSQL_CONN图片这样便好看多了.以后有导出授权DDL时候就可以跑这个命令了....当然导出创建用户DDL也是同理, 其它DDL都是同理.

    49330

    MySQL练习二:查询入职日期倒数第三员工信息

    -24'); INSERT INTO employees VALUES(10011,'1953-11-07','Mary','Sluis','F','1990-01-22'); 解题思路: 首先此题是查询入职日期倒数第三日期...根据日期需要去插入对应,这一天入职所有员工信息。 此题容易忽略同一天入职日期存在多个,例如2019-06-05存在多个,这时候倒数第三或许就是不真实倒数第三日期。因此在查询时候,需要考虑。...可以使用group对日期做一个分组,也可以使用district对日期进行去重,得到日期就是唯一根据得到日期,作为一个临时表,作为查询所有员工信息。...参考答案: 使用distinct进行排重查询。...where hire_date = (select distinct hire_date from employees order by hire_date limit 2,1); 使用group对日期去重查询

    1.1K00

    Django 如何使用日期时间选择器规范用户时间输入示例代码详解

    如果你模型中含有 datetime 类型字段,表单中需要用户输入日期和时间,那么你如何保证不同用户输入时间都遵循一定格式 (DD/MM/YYYY 或者 YYYY-MM-DD) 是个必须要考虑问题...一个更好方式是在前端使用日期时间选择器 DateTimePicker,以日历形式统一选择输入时间,如下图所示。...小编今天将尝试以最少代码教你实现如何在 Django 项目中实现日期时间选择器 DateTimePicker。 ?...,美观日期和时间选择器就出现了,如下图所示: ?...总结 到此这篇关于Django 如何使用日期时间选择器规范用户时间输入文章就介绍到这了,更多相关 Django 如何使用日期时间选择器规范用户时间输入内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持

    6K20

    基于 element-plus 封装一个依赖 json 动态渲染查询控件 文本数字单选组查询勾选和开关级联选择日期年、年月、年周查询日期时间查询快速查询自定义查询方案更多查询

    " ] } 日期 日期查询比较复杂,这里对应数据类型是date,选择后返回数据是“2021-05-20”形式。...然后就是如何让用户感觉爽问题了。 常规查询方式 ? 一般都是如上图所示,直接选择日期范围,这个看起来似乎没有啥问题,可以选择任意日期。...如果用户选择多个月份日期,可以通过“从” + “年月”形式,选择起始月份即可,返回数据是"2021-01-01", "2021-03-31" 形式。 ?...不过这还没有结束,还有选择“年”情况。 通过年查询日期范围 如果要查询一年或者多年日期范围呢?我们可以选择“年”方式。 ?...,和用户选择查询方式。

    2.1K20

    基于MySQL数据库下亿级数据分库分表

    这次优化之后,我们插入快了许多,但是查询依然很慢,为什么,因为在做查询时候,我们也只是根据银行卡或者证件号进行查询,并没有根据时间查询,相当于每次查询MySQL都会将所有的分区表查询一遍。...分区表设置,一般是以查询索引列进行分区,例如,对于流水表A,查询需要根据手机号和批次号进行查询,所以我们在创建分区时候,就选择以手机号和批次号进行分区,这样设置后,查询都会走索引,每次查询MySQL...,继续保存当日流水,而临时表2则保存是昨天数据和部分今天数据,临时表2到名字中date时间是通过计算获得昨日日期;每天会产生一张带有昨日日期临时表2,每个表内数据大约是有1000万。...将当日表中历史数据迁移到昨日流水表中去 这样操作都是用定时任务进行处理,定时任务触发一般会选择凌晨12点以后,这个操作即时是几秒内完成,也有可能会有几条数据落入到当日表中去。...大致做法时,根据客户选择时间区间段,带上查询条件,分别去时间区间段内每一张表内查询,将查询结果保存到一张临时表内,然后,再去查询临时表获得最终查询结果。

    1.7K60

    基于MySQL数据库下亿级数据分库分表

    这次优化之后,我们插入快了许多,但是查询依然很慢,为什么,因为在做查询时候,我们也只是根据银行卡或者证件号进行查询,并没有根据时间查询,相当于每次查询MySQL都会将所有的分区表查询一遍。...分区表设置,一般是以查询索引列进行分区,例如,对于流水表A,查询需要根据手机号和批次号进行查询,所以我们在创建分区时候,就选择以手机号和批次号进行分区,这样设置后,查询都会走索引,每次查询MySQL...,继续保存当日流水,而临时表2则保存是昨天数据和部分今天数据,临时表2到名字中date时间是通过计算获得昨日日期;每天会产生一张带有昨日日期临时表2,每个表内数据大约是有1000万。...将当日表中历史数据迁移到昨日流水表中去 这样操作都是用定时任务进行处理,定时任务触发一般会选择凌晨12点以后,这个操作即时是几秒内完成,也有可能会有几条数据落入到当日表中去。...大致做法时,根据客户选择时间区间段,带上查询条件,分别去时间区间段内每一张表内查询,将查询结果保存到一张临时表内,然后,再去查询临时表获得最终查询结果。

    2.7K60

    用户画像 | 标签数据存储之Elasticsearch真实应用

    在实际应用中,经常有根据特定几个字段进行组合后检索应用场景,而 HBase 采用 rowkey 作为一级索引,不支持多条件查询,如果要对库里非 rowkey 进行数据检索和查询,往往需要通过 MapReduce...主要查询过程包括: 1)在Elasticsearch中存放用于检索条件数据,并将rowkey 也存储进去; 2)使用Elasticsearch API 根据组合标签条件查询出...在与 Elasticsearch 数据同步完成并通过校验后,向在 MySQL 中维护状态表中插入一条状态记录,表示当前日期 Elasticsearch 数据可用,线上计算用户人群接口则读取最近日期对应数据...例如,数据同步完成后向MySQL状态表“elasticsearch_state”中插入记录(如图所示),当日数据产出正常时,state字段为“0”,产出异常时为“1”。...,如通过校验,更新MySQL状态位 def update_es_data(data_date): ''' data_date: 查询数据日期 ''' esdata = monitor_es_data

    3.7K21

    数据治理(四):数据仓库数据质量管理

    中导入对应库数据向MySQL中导入ycak 与ycbk两个库数据。...,所以这里检验时一般不需要验证与原始数据条目是否相同,在ODS层数据质量监控中一般验证当日导入数据记录数、当日导入表中关注字段为空记录数、当日导入数据关注字段重复记录数、全表总记录数指标即可。...5个参数:校验数据日期、Hive库名、校验表名、是否增量(1代表增量,2代表全量)、校验为空字段。...对DWD层数据质量校验关注点在于是否与ODS层对应数据来源表数据记录数是否一致、导入到DWD层数据有效比例等,针对不同DWD层数据表也可以根据具体业务来决定质量检验内容。...针对不同DWS层数据表也可以根据具体业务来决定质量检验内容。以上EDS层中各层数据质量校验具体校验内容一般根据业务不同是不同,不能抛开业务来谈数据质量,可以使用具体脚本个性化校验。

    1.3K43

    用户画像标签是如何生成

    其统计语句如下所示,该语句涉及子查询语句,需要先统计查询出每一个用户被举报详细次数,然后在外层查询根据被举报次数多少判断最近一周是否被举报,1代表是0代表否。...导入标签 导入类标签依赖用户上传数据来构建新标签,用户导入数据方式主要分为文件上传、从其他数据源导入(如MySQL,Hive)两种方式。...比如“当日实时分享数量”标签,记录了用户从当天凌晨开始到当前时刻累计分享次数;“当日是否被举报”标签记录了用户当日是否被举报,当举报事件发生时,用户该标签值可以实时更新为“被举报”。...“当日实时分享数量”标签与日期有关,需要区分出不同日期标签数据。可以借助分享时间戳计算当前日期根据不同日期构建不同Redis Key前缀,比如dt:20220626和dt:20220627。...比如用户兴趣爱好标签,需要根据用户过往历史行为挖掘出用户兴趣爱好及概率值;用户婚育情况标签也无法直接从现有数据中统计获取到,需要借助用户历史行为进行挖掘,预测用户是否已婚已育。

    56300

    游戏行业实战案例1:日活跃率分析

    /当日活跃玩家总数) 1.计算开服首日游戏DAU(日活跃玩家数) 游戏DAU(日活跃玩家数),第一步就是要明确什么是日活跃玩家数,日活跃玩家数表示当日至少登录过游戏一次不重复玩家数。...根据题意可知,当日即为开服首日(2022-08-13),因此,我们要用where子句筛选出日期为“2022-08-13”数据: where 日期 = '2022-08-13' 至少登录过游戏一次表示登录过游戏即可...完整SQL书写方法: select count(distinct 角色id) as 日活跃玩家数 from 登录日志 where 日期 = '2022-08-13'; 查询结果如下: 2.次日留存率...-08-14' and 角色id in ( select 角色id from 登录日志 where 日期 = '2022-08-13'); 查询结果如下: 现在,们在前面结果基础上计算开服首日次日留存率...; 根据次日留存率计算方法可知,计算次日仍登录活跃玩家数count(distinct 角色id)/计算首日登录活跃用户count(distinct 角色id)即为次日留存率。

    60730
    领券